440ml can. Opalescant, amber colour with average to huge, thick, creamy, moderately to mostly lasting, moderately lacing, off-white head. Relatively weak, piney, resinous and citrusy, hoppy aroma, pale and caramel malty background, hints of lemon, mandarine, orange, some almond. Taste is immensely bitter, slightly resinous and piney, minimally citrusy hoppy, caramel malty backbone with low residual sweetness, a zesty touch of orange, mineral overtones. Oily texture, smooth and soft palate, fine and soft, creamy carbonation. Pungent bitterness, restricted amount and intensity of hop flavours - OK.
